Khargone: The Madhya Pradesh government has sanctioned a sum of Rs 1 crore to help the victims of Khargone violence. Along with this, the government also issued revised orders to help the affected person and families in communal riots. The District Magistrate had demanded sanction of an annexure amount of Rs.1 crore for the persons and families affected by the communal riots in Khargone. Which has been approved by the Government.  

At the same time, in communal riots, the family of the deceased will be given a compensation of Rs 4 lakh, the injured persons will get Rs 2 lakh for having more than 80 per cent disability, Rs 59,100 for disability between 40 and 60 per cent and Rs 25,000 on consultation with a doctor in case of minor injuries.

At the same time, 6 thousand rupees will be given for the loss of movable property, permanent property such as a house, raw house in case of complete destruction of the shop, according to the estimate, a maximum of 95 thousand 100 rupees will be given and 95 thousand 100 rupees for a pucca house, a maximum of 6 thousand rupees for a slum/hut. At the same time, the Integrated Action Plan will be given a maximum of Rs 1 lakh 1 thousand 900 for a completely destroyed pucca or kutcha house in the cities. In addition, 12,000 rupees will be given in case of loss of means of livelihood such as vehicles, boats, bullocks, etc.
